I am an American fashion designer studying at SCAD, exploring clothing as a way to translate personal emotions, experiences, and observations into tangible forms. My work is rooted in the relationship between the body and material, drawing from memory, identity, and everyday life. My practice includes knitting, textile development, and patternmaking, with a focus on how construction and material can shape the emotional language of a garment.
I co-founded and currently lead SCAD’s first fashion film club, creating a collaborative space for students to explore the intersection of fashion, film, photography, and visual storytelling. I organize workshops, guest speakers, and film screenings, and I lead creative projects and productions from concept development through execution. Ambedo has produced and supported 5+ senior fashion films and helped facilitate the screening of 10+ student fashion films.
